The Underwater Salvage Commandments
Last updated 2026-08-10
The Underwater Salvage Commandments is an Event World Quest in the Court of Fontaine Region, Fontaine. It is accessed during the Sunny Summer Fontinalia Event.
Steps
- Talk to Freminet
Dialogue
Freminet seems to have something to tell us...
- (Approach the marked location)
-
- (Freminet is sitting on a bench near the side of The Wingalet's Deck in a morose silence, then the Traveler and Paimon approach him)
- Paimon: Freminet? You look exhausted! You haven't been working yourself too hard, have you?
- Freminet: Uhm...
- (Freminet puts on his diving helmet)
- Paimon: Hey! Don't you go hiding inside your diving helmet! We're your friends. You'll feel a lot better if you let it all out.
- (By now, Freminet has already taken his diving helmet off)
- Freminet: ...*sigh* I guess you're right.
- Freminet: I bumped into a real piece of work while diving just now.
- Paimon: A real piece of work?
- Freminet: Yeah... How can I explain it... According to Fontainian law, if an owner of sunken cargo accepts an insurance payout, the cargo becomes unclaimed property.
- Freminet: Because of this, some people see diving as a way to get rich. They salvage things others have lost, and sell them for Mora back on dry land...
- Freminet: This line of work doesn't require much skill, which means there are plenty of divers who are... well, the sort who only care about money.
- Freminet: They often resort to barbaric means to drive away fish and Blubberbeasts, just to gain access to valuable salvage... It's largely because of people like them that I don't pick up certain commissions.
- Paimon: So that's what's bothering you... Paimon can really sympathize with how you feel.
- Freminet: Just now, while I was diving, I ran into someone driving away the wildlife. I mustered up the courage and managed to stop them, but it ended with them saying some pretty unpleasant things.
- Paimon: That's awful...
You did the right thing!
We can stop them for you next time!- Freminet: Thanks for the kind offer, but... even though it's difficult and leaves me feeling drained, I still want to stand up for what's right and try to make a change myself.
- Freminet: I love swimming underwater, seeing the patterns of Beryl Conches, feeling the breath of Romaritime Flowers...
- Freminet: When the underwater world accepts you, it responds with kindness.
- Freminet: I believe that's how we should interact with nature, rather than just selfishly taking whatever we want.
- Paimon: Wow, Freminet, Paimon thinks everything you just said was great! See? When you have something you really want to say or do, doesn't it feel much better to just get it off your chest?
- (Freminet puts on his diving helmet again)
- Freminet: Uhm...
- Paimon: Freminet?
- Freminet: I'm sorry... I'm still a little bit shy. But don't worry... I—I'll keep working on it.
- Freminet: Oh, I almost forgot... Here's the latest underwater survey data. Please take it, I'm sure you'll find it helpful.
